WARNING: Never power up the switch if no fan module is installed. (Fixed-fan switches always have a fan module installed.) WARNING: Prevent exposure and contact with hazardous voltages. Do not attempt to operate this switch with the safety cover removed. To comply with the GR-1089 Lightning Criteria for Equipment Interfacing with AC or DC Power Ports, use an external surge protection device (SPD) at the AC or DC input of the router. WARNING: Equipment that provides DC input to the DC port must be certified for CCC and meet the relevant standards. WARNING: This equipment must be grounded. Connect the power plug to a properly wired earth-ground socket outlet. Cautions CAUTION: Operate the equipment at an ambient temperature not higher than 45°C (113°F). CAUTION: Stationary pluggable equipment Type-A used in a location with equipotential bonding, such as a telecommunication center, a dedicated computer room, or a restricted access area, must have installation instructions that require protective earth-ground connection verification by a skilled electrician. Notes NOTE: If necessary, to upgrade your software or firmware images, go to the Drivers and Downloads page of your switch at www.dell.com/support/. NOTE: For proper ventilation, position the switch with a minimum of 12.7 cm (5 in) of clearance around the exhaust vents. NOTE: Install the switch into a rack or cabinet before installing any additional components such as cables or optics. NOTE: For the N3208PX-ON switch only: If you are using two external power adapters (EPAs) in a two-post front or center mount, you must have two-rack units space available in your rack. Install the switch in the bottom portion of the two-rack units and the EPA in the top portion above the switch. NOTE: Dell Technologies recommends you ground your switch. Use the switch in a common bond network (CBN). Grounding conductors must be made of copper. Copper conductors offer better conductivity and durability.
